Describe your problem, get the YC startup that solves it
YC has it is an innovative search tool designed for entrepreneurs, investors, and startup enthusiasts who want to quickly identify the right YC-backed startup solutions for their problems. Users can simply describe a challenge in plain English, and the platform searches through over 4,000 active YC companies to find relevant startups that address that issue. The tool provides detailed reasoning, pricing insights, and available integrations, making it a valuable resource for discovering tailored technological solutions without any login or signup requirements. Its ease of use and comprehensive database make it particularly appealing for those seeking quick, reliable startup recommendations in a clutter-free environment.

Translate text in your videos without recreating visuals
Visual Translate by Vozo is a groundbreaking SaaS tool designed to simplify the process of creating multilingual videos by translating on-screen text without the need to recreate visuals. It seamlessly detects and translates text embedded within videos—such as slides, callouts, labels, and diagrams—while maintaining the original layout, style, and animations. This makes it an ideal solution for content creators, educators, marketers, and businesses aiming to reach a global audience without the time-consuming process of re-editing videos from scratch. By integrating voice dubbing, lip-sync, and subtitle translation, Visual Translate offers a comprehensive approach to multilingual video localization, saving users significant time and effort while expanding their reach.
